
The Gospel of Judas paints a very different picture than the one in the other gospels. I paints a picture of Judas was the only one of the disciples who understood the truth. We've researched this, very little information of who Judas was or his family. Some historians say Judas wrote this, some say you can connect it with Jude in the bible that he wrote it. Then some say no one knows who wrote it. Some say it was written in the 1st century then again some say it was 2nd or 3rd century. Regardless it flips the bibles teaching upside down whoever wrote it. It was rediscovered in Egypt in the 1970's and translated in 2006 and just now getting popular as a gnostic text. Very little is known about it or Judas for that matter. We really don't know who he was, the bible portrays him as greedy, this book portrays him as Jesus best guy.
